Position Objective
The Volunteer Manager has responsibility for effectively meeting the volunteer goals that advance the mission of Family Life Services, as determined by the Executive Director. The primary areas of responsibility are volunteer recruitment and deployment.
Position Responsibilities
Recruitment
1. Find and use a variety of platforms to spread the word about volunteer opportunities at FLS.
2. Follow up on all inquiries about volunteer opportunities by individuals and groups.
a. For individuals, interview, complete background check, and create match for skills and time available.
b. For groups, find mutually acceptable projects and dates.
3. Work with Community Relations Manager to recruit volunteers from partner churches.
Deployment
1. With Community Relations Manager, grow FLS’ strategic deployment of volunteers to meet needs of FLS.
2. Coordinate and supervise volunteer groups
a. Share mission of FLS and invite group volunteers into higher level of engagement with FLS. Give tours of 2-acre campus to groups/individuals.
b. With the Operations Manager, coordinate projects and all logistics to set up volunteers for a successful experience.
c. Supervise execution of work by volunteer groups.
d. Input volunteer records into digital platform
4. Warmly transfer approved, individual volunteers to appropriate staff supervisor.
5. With Community Relations Manager, coordinate volunteer appreciation and other methods of expanding volunteers’ connection and support to FLS and its mission.
6. Coordinate and execute City Serve day and seasonal increase of volunteers (such as Christmas and summer).
Other duties, as needed and directed by the Community Relations Manager. This position requires in person hours on Monday evenings, 4:30 – 7:00, and 4 – 6 hours on approximately 8 Saturdays per year.
